用MATLAB求解多项式3x⁴-10x³+15x-1000的根。
时间: 2024-02-03 15:14:35 浏览: 153
可以使用MATLAB中的`roots`函数来求解多项式方程的根。首先,将多项式系数存储在向量中,然后将向量传递给`roots`函数。以下是MATLAB代码:
```
% 存储多项式系数
coefficients = [3, -10, 0, 15, -1000];
% 求解多项式方程的根
roots(coefficients)
```
运行代码后,MATLAB将输出多项式的四个根:
```
ans =
-5.0000 + 0.0000i
2.0000 + 0.0000i
0.0000 + 1.2901i
0.0000 - 1.2901i
```
其中,前两个根是实数,后两个根是复数。
阅读全文